import requests
from credentials import LinodeServerImageUploadAPIURL, SZDIYCamAPIBaseURL
def __upload(files):
print "uploading image to linode"
requests.post(LinodeServerImageUploadAPIURL,files=files, timeout=20) #set time out at 20 secs
print "image upload complete"
def uploadAFileToLinode(fileLocation):
aFile = open(fileLocation,'rb')
files = {'file': aFile}
try:
__upload(files)
except:
print "Network seems down, try again later..."
aFile.close();
def uploadAFileToLinodeWithWXMediaID(fileLocation, media_id, created_at):
print "uploading image to linode"
aFile = open(fileLocation,'rb')
files = {'file': aFile}
try:
postAddress = SZDIYCamAPIBaseURL+'/'+str(media_id)+'/'+str(created_at)+'/upload'
r = requests.post(postAddress,files=files, timeout=20) #set time out at 20 secs
print r
except:
print "Network seems down, try again later..."
aFile.close();
